Macrourimegatrema gadoma n. sp. (Digenea: Opecoelidae: Plagioporinae) is described from the pyloric caeca and intestine of the doublethread grenadier Gadomus arcuatus (Goode & Bean) (Macrouridae) collected from the northeastern Gulf of Mexico and off Venezuela. The new species differs from Macrourimegatrema brayi Blend, Dronen & Armstrong, 2004, the type and only species in the genus, in the distribution of the vitelline follicles and gonads, a larger body size, and the presence of highly-folded caeca with numerous outpocketings or pouches. It is suggested that species of Macrourimegatrema Blend, Dronen & Armstrong, 2004 probably infect their piscine hosts through the ingestion of a benthopelagic crustacean.  相似文献

Abstract Ninety‐six species of the rove beetle genus Dianous Leach, 1819 have been recorded in China. In this paper, we describe a new species, D. poecilus n. sp. from Yunnan, and record D. viriditinctus ( Champion, 1920 ) for the first time from China. To facilitate identification of species, species groups and/or species complexes, we compiled a new version of keys, including all species of Dianous hitherto recorded in the territory of China. Moreover, main patterns of geographical distribution are outlined for the world Dianous fauna of this genus.  相似文献

在云南省新平县(24°N,101°32’E)采集的华西雨蛙Hyla a.annectans膀胱内检获多盘虫属1新种,新平多盘虫Polystoma xinpingensis sp.nov.。124只华西雨蛙中18只华西雨蛙感染,自然感染率为14.5%。新种与多盘虫属记录种最显著的区别在于:虫体体型小,其体长仅为2967μm。内侧肠管于虫体后1/3处仅形成2条横跨虫体的联合肠管,其它记录种肠管分支多数或形成较复杂的网状。睾丸巨大,呈滤泡状,分散分布直达虫体中部。新种的正、副模式标本保存在云南师范大学生命科学学院。  相似文献

A new genus, Asiaontsira gen. nov., and two new species, A. cucphuongi sp. nov. (type species) and A. cantonica sp. nov., are described from tropical and subtropical areas of South‐East China and North Vietnam. This genus is compared to the closely related Australian Ontsirospathius Belokobylskij, Iqbal and Austin, 2004 as well as the similar and almost cosmopolitan genus Ontsira Cameron, 1900. A key to both species of Asiaontsira gen. nov. is provided.  相似文献

The Palaearctic burrower bug genus Canthophorus Mulsant & Rey, 1866 (Heteroptera: Cydnidae) is revised. New data on the morphology and distribution are given. Structures of the female internal ectodermal terminalia and the completely inflated aedeagi in all species of the genus are described and illustrated for the first time. An extended differential diagnosis as a comparison with representatives of all Palearctic genera of the tribe Sehirini is given for the genus. Based on characters of the external morphology and terminalia of both sexes, new taxa are described: C. dubius sanigarum n. ssp., C. melanopterus mariae n. ssp., C. impressus hajastanicus n. ssp., and C. wagneri hyrcanicus n. ssp.; C. hissaricus Asanova, 1964 is downgraded to a subspecies level and included in C. mixtus Asanova, 1964. C. melanopterus niger (Vidal, 1950) is placed in synonymy with C. melanopterus melanopterus (Herrich-Schaeffer, 1835). A wide variability of the terminalia, especially in females, was found in C. melanopterus melanopterus; in the latter, six forms are described differing in the shape and size of sclerites in posterior pouches of the gynatrial sac and distributed mainly in the Mediterranean region. A key allowing identification of the species not only by males, but also by females, was compiled for the first time. It is shown that C. aeneus (Walker, 1867) [= Sehirus fuscipennis Horváth, 1899] and C. maculipes (Mulsant & Rey, 1852) have very significant differences from other species of Canthophorus in the male and female terminalia, and at the same time share some characters with the genus Adomerus Mulsant & Rey, 1866, including unique characters shared with several species of this group; therefore, the mentioned two species are transferred to the genus Adomerus.  相似文献

A new species of Alboglossiphonia (Hirudinea: Glossiphoniidae) from Egypt   总被引:1,自引:0,他引:1  
A new Alboglossiphonia species from Egypt is described and figured. This leech is placed in the genus Alboglossiphonia on the basis of having three pairs of eyes, diffuse salivary glands, seven pairs of crop caeca, and the attachment of its eggs to the venter. It differs from other Alboglossiphonia species with seven pairs of crop caeca in its combination of very prominent dorsal papillae, two annuli between the gonopores, lobed first six pairs of crop caeca, and paired ducts of male system at peak of activity with conspicuously differentiated sperm duct, seminal vesicle and ejaculatory duct regions.  相似文献

New material of Achaeta species was collected from a small portion of the tropical rain forest region of Brazil's east coast. For A. neotropica Cernosvitov, wider ranges of variation of several morphological characters are described and four varieties are recognized. Achaeta iridescens sp.n. differs from other species of the genus by the presence of intestinal pouches in segment VII. Both species are peculiar to Achaeta in that they have compact glandular masses surrounding the male pores and a more posterior origin of the dorsal vessel; they share with a few European and most non-European species the tendency to show a complete regression of some morphological characters, namely the setal follicles, oesophageal appendages and dorsal connection of the third pair of septal glands.  相似文献

Japanese species of the genus Dolophilodes subgenus Dolophilodes are revised taxonomically. Seven described species are recognized: D. japonicus (Banks), D. shinboensis (Kobayashi), D. auriculatus Martynov, D. nomugiensis (Kobayashi), D. babai (Kobayashi), D. iroensis (Kobayashi) and D. commatus (Kobayashi). In addition, two new species, D. angustatus and D. dilatatus, are described. Males of all nine species and females of all but D. babai are described and illustrated. The subgenus Hisaura Kobayashi is synonymized under the subgenus Dolophilodes. Three synonymies of species proposed are Wormaldia triangulata Kobayashi under D. nomugiensis, D. kunashirensis Ivanov under D. iroensis and Sortosa kaishoensis Kobayashi under D. commatus.  相似文献

Abstract The new species, Foonchewia guangdongensis R. J. Wang & H. Z. Wen and the new monotypic genus Foonchewia R. J. Wang (Rubioideae, Rubiaceae), are described from eastern Guangdong, China. It is characterized by its subshrub habit, pentamerous and heterostylous flowers, 2‐1ocular ovary with many ovules, and apically dehiscent capsules with numerous angulated seeds. Phylogenetic analysis of four chloroplast DNA regions (rbcL, rps16, ndhF, and atpBrbcL) revealed that the new genus is nested in the Spermacoceae alliance and is sister to Dunnia. Morphological comparison between these two genera indicated that they had few synapomorphies; it was therefore inappropriate to classify the new genus in the existing tribe Dunnieae, and a new tribe, Foonchewieae R. J. Wang, is accordingly proposed.  相似文献

Abstract The genus Donaciolagria Pic is transferred from the subfamily Lagriinae to the subfamily Statirinae. The species Donaciolagria femoralis (brchmann) is redescribed. Two new species, D. viridimetallica sp. nov. and D. flavitibialis sp. nov. are described. A key to Chinese species of the genus is given. With 22 original pictures.  相似文献

Transitroides morsei new genus, new species, is described from late Oligocene Early Miocene amber deposits of Chiapas Province from southern Mexico. This new taxon is the first known fossil member of the amphipod family Talitridae and superfamily Talitroidea. It appears intermediate between regional extant palustral (salt‐marsh) genera and fully terrestrial landhoppers of the genus Caribitroides. These beetle‐like crustaceans form a significant part of the forest‐floor leaf‐litter communities in some tropical parts of the globe. Extant terrestrial amphipods occur in south‐central Mexico and adjacent rain forest habitats in Central America and the Caribbean. Their occasional use of arboreal habitats in search for decaying organic matter, which serves as food, explains their occurrence in fossilized resin.  相似文献

A new species‐group of the dobsonfly genus Protohermes is proposed, the Protohermes xanthodes species‐group. Three species from eastern Asia belonging to the new species‐group are redescribed and illustrated. Phylogenetic relationships among the species in this group, as well as the biogeography of these species, are discussed on the basis of a cladistic analysis.  相似文献

This contribution provides new insights in the phylogeny and taxonomy of the nematode genus Sectonema with an integrative approach. A brief historical outline of the matter is presented. Then, the morphological pattern of the genus is revised and illustrated, the nature of its stomatal protruding structure, either a reduced odontostyle or a mural tooth, being its most relevant diagnostic feature. The existence of cilia‐ or seta‐like structures in the perioral area and/or at the anterior part of cheilostom of some species is evidenced by SEM observations for the first time. Available molecular data (D2–D3 LSU‐rRNA gene) are analysed, including two new sequences of S. septentrionale from Spain. The monophyly of the genus is confirmed, and two species groups with geographical projection are tentatively identified. A close relationship with Metaporcelaimus is also demonstrated as both taxa constitute a highly supported clade. A likely polyphyly of the family Aporcelaimidae is once more demonstrated. Finally, an updated taxonomy of the genus is proposed, including revised diagnosis, list of species, identification key and a compendium of their main morphometrics.  相似文献

A new species of Catatropis Oghner, 1905 from a freshwater Neotropical prosobranch snail, Heleobia hatcheri (Hydrobiidae), is described. Naturally infected snails were collected from Nahuel Huapí Lake in Andean Patagonia. The characteristics of the larval stages are also presented. Experimental adults were recovered from the distal region of the intestinal caeca of chicks and ducklings and natural adults from a wild duck Anas platyrhynchos. Adults of Catatropis hatcheri n. sp. can be distinguished from all other species of the genus in having 10–12 (11) ventral glands in each lateral row, the cirrus-sac extending back to between the first third and the middle of the body, the metraterm shorter than the cirrus-sac, a previtelline field of 1,258–1,544 (1,396), vitelline follicles reach back to the anterior border of the testes with some follicles extending slightly lateral to them, only external testicular margin lobed and genital pore in median line just posterior to the intestinal bifurcation. In addition, the eggs have one filament on each pole, the rediae contain one or two mature cercariae, and the cercariae are tri-oculate, with a long tail and encyst in the environment.  相似文献

Strzeleckia major n. g., n. sp. and S. minor n. sp. are described from the dusky antechinus Antechinus swainsonii (Marsupialia: Dasyuridae) from the Kosciusko National Park in southern New South Wales, Australia. The two species were found together in the same individual host animals but occupy different sites in the intestine. The new genus is placed within the Hasstilesiidae, where it differs from the only other genus, Hasstilesia, by being more elongate and in having larger suckers, tandem testes, the ovary between rather than opposite the testes, and in having the caeca not reaching the posterior end of the body. It is suggested that the life-cycles of these species are similar to those of other hasstilesiids. Pupillid snails may act as sole intermediate hosts.  相似文献

The small genus Dialipsis Förster 1869 (Hymenoptera: Ichneumonidae) includes two known species, of which one is common in Central and Northern Europe. Here we describe the male and female of a new species, Dialipsis villahermosae Humala & Selfa, which was reared from mushrooms collected in Eastern Spain. The host fungus gnat, Mycetophila blanda Winnertz, is a new record for the whole genus, while the rate of parasitism seems very low. Based on environmental data of the collection localities and data available for other two species it is suggested that Dialipsis species occur preferably in cool temperatures habitats. A key of identification of the two known Palaearctic species is provided. D. villahermosae n. sp. differs from D. exilis Förster 1871 in the morphology of the first tergite, referred to the presence of dorsal keels and angle between petiole and postpetiole, and in the convexity of temples.  相似文献
